About 6 Crescent Lodge
6 Crescent Lodge is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Middlesbrough (TS5 6SF). It has a recorded floor area of 67 m² (around 721 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(January 2022) shows a C (score 75), near the top of the C band. The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.
11 years since the last transfer (February 2015). Today's modelled estimate of £101,000 is 32.9% above the 2015 sale price.
